Transaction 71c85adec8149a84df8669cfd0bdec0b0a0e83e9c86708246bb50c7dc7c7681d

23 Input
2 Outputs
  • 71c85adec8149a84df8669cfd0bdec0b0a0e83e9c86708246bb50c7dc7c7681d:0
  • value  9898225
    address  36d8AewQvoKjHPbaeFFkqJHpoZ8wnrTMeU
  • 71c85adec8149a84df8669cfd0bdec0b0a0e83e9c86708246bb50c7dc7c7681d:1
  • value  202075
    address  3Cz3YMFSyv4bDcZM93cvfAN5xN7fVGoboG